Motor Mounts

Hi Alpinegt Maybe You Should Check Your Motor Mounts Is Is Easy To Get Them Reversed And Thus Set The Engine Higher And Further To The Front Of The Car .the Diff. On The Mount Is Only About 1/4 In. But It Makes A World In Diff. You Can Check By Measuering The Distance From The Stud That Comes Out Of The Rubber Mount On Each Side You Will Find That The Stud Is Offset And The Shortest Side Goes To The Rear . Had My Engine In With Two Left Side Mounts And That Cerated A Real Problem. Note; They Were Ordered And Supposed To Be A Pair Of New Mounts. It Took A While To Figure Out The Problem Because I Assumed That The Mounts Were Correct. You Can Also Drop The Engine A Little By Placing A Washer Or Spacer Between The Two Top Attachment Points Ofthe Motor Mount Struts Where They Attach To The Body . It Changes The Angle Of The Strut And Allows The Engine To Drop Little. A Little Here And A Little There Is What You Have To Do With A Sunbeam. Good Luck Earl Blu Oval
